Description
Nantex Industry Co., Ltd., a global enterprise operating with its subsidiaries, specializes in the production, processing, and distribution of a diverse range of latex, rubber, and associated materials. Their product portfolio includes NANTEX synthetic rubber latex, widely utilized in the manufacturing of various gloves (such as examination, medical, household, and industrial types). It also finds applications in art papers, coated whiteboards, carpet backing, shoe insoles, non-woven fabric saturation (including those for artificial leathers), adhesives, plastic modifiers, and construction materials. Additionally, Nantex supplies NANCAR acrylonitrile-butadiene rubber, which is integral to the production of industrial and automotive components, including O-rings, gaskets, fuel hoses, shoe soles, various car parts, insulation systems, sporting equipment, rollers, and electronic components. Furthermore, they market DYNAPRENE thermoplastic elastomers, essential for automotive parts, building materials, components across the food and 3C sectors, sports merchandise, industrial goods, medical devices, and as agents for plastic modification. Another offering is NANCAR carbon masterbatch compounds, specifically designed for applications like O-rings, gaskets, fuel hoses, shoe soles, and other automotive components. Tracing its origins, the company was established in 1979 under the name President Fine Chemical Industry Co. Ltd., before adopting its current identity as NANTEX Industry Co., Ltd. in October 1991. Its headquarters are located in Kaohsiung, Taiwan.
